Matplotlib savefig pdf не отображает некоторые многоугольникиPython

Программы на Python
Ответить
Anonymous
 Matplotlib savefig pdf не отображает некоторые многоугольники

Сообщение Anonymous »

Я создаю относительно простой сюжет, который, кажется, работает нормально. У меня есть несколько сегментов линий, каждый из которых определяет область. Я использую многоугольники для закрашенных областей, используяplot.Polygon и ax.add_patch.

Когда я сохраняю в .png, все работает нормально. Итак, я перехожу к PDF для окончательного изображения. Я вручную установил такие параметры, как размер шрифта, figsize и dpi, поэтому проблем быть не должно.

К сожалению, 2 из четырех полигонов на текущем изображении не отображаются в PDF-файле. Что странно; предыдущие два изображения (другие наборы данных) действовали правильно. Я немного поигрался с zorder и альфа на полигонах, но безрезультатно.

Мой поиск в Google ничего не дал; там упоминалось, что разрешение будет другим, если вы не установили его вручную, но это не проблема. Помимо этого, я не смог найти четких причин.

Моя искренняя благодарность,
Даймони

Подробнее здесь: https://stackoverflow.com/questions/364 ... e-polygons
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Python»